Regarding plasma protein, all of the following are correct EXCEPT:

A. albumin, globulin and fibrinogen constitute the major plasma proteins in the plasma
B. the fibrinogen polymerises into long fibrin threads during blood coagulation
C. the principal function of albumin is to provide colloid osmotic pressure in the plasma
D. the majority of plasma proteins are formed in the lymphoid tissue
E. rapid loss of plasma proteins may occur during severe burns
Answer» D. the majority of plasma proteins are formed in the lymphoid tissue
